Mini excavators have become essential in construction and landscaping. Their undercarriage components play a crucial role in their performance. Understanding these parts can enhance maintenance and efficiency.
Key features of mini excavator undercarriage components include tracks, rollers, and drive motors. The tracks should provide maximum traction while minimizing ground pressure. This balance is vital for operations on soft or uneven terrain. Rollers should be durable and capable of withstanding heavy loads. However, they can wear out quickly if not maintained properly.
Drive motors are another critical component. They power the tracks, allowing the mini excavator to move smoothly. A malfunctioning motor can disrupt workflow. Regular inspections can help identify issues early. Though they are often overlooked, these parts require attention. Neglecting them can lead to bigger problems down the road. Maintaining the undercarriage of mini excavators is crucial for their longevity. A recent industry report found that proper maintenance can extend equipment life by up to 30%. Operators should regularly inspect tracks, rollers, and idlers for wear and tear. Neglected parts can lead to costly repairs and downtime.
Routine cleaning is essential. Dirt and debris can accumulate, causing premature component failure. A simple wash can prevent corrosion and extend the life of the undercarriage. Employees must be trained to recognize signs of wear. Ignoring small issues can lead to bigger problems down the line.
Tracking performance data is also useful. Studies show that operators who keep detailed maintenance logs can identify patterns and learn when parts are due for replacement. Investing in quality parts for repairs is vital, even if it feels costly upfront. Skimping can result in increased service frequency. The mini excavator industry is evolving quickly. As we approach the 2026 Canton Fair, undercarriage technology will take center stage. Recent reports indicate a growing demand for lightweight materials. Aluminum and advanced polymers are preferred. They provide enhanced durability and reduce overall weight. This shift can improve fuel efficiency by 15% or more.
Tips for choosing the right undercarriage parts include assessing terrain compatibility. Not all undercarriage types suit every job site. Some users overlook this factor, leading to increased wear and tear. Another point to consider is maintenance frequency. Regular inspections can facilitate better long-term performance. It can also help avoid costly repairs down the line.
The future may integrate automation and smart sensors within undercarriage systems. Some manufacturers are experimenting with IoT features. These can provide real-time data on wear levels and performance metrics. However, user experience with such products remains mixed. Many operators need time to adapt to these advancements. The shift to smarter technology is progressive but challenging.
